I'm not cis, and that's okay. Celebratory

TW: dysphoria/bottom dysphoria

Recently I've been doing a lot of self-work and I've actually discovered that I'm okay with not being a cis male. I believe my existence is just as valid as being cis would be.

I've also discovered that I've never wanted to be a cis man, I just thought that was the only way to be a man. But being cis isn't the only way to be a man. Yes it'd be more convenient, but my body is valid too. I'm content with wearing my prosthetic. And I'm content with having top surgery scars, I actually think they're pretty cool.

Some men are born, others are created. And that's okay, we can co-exist without comparing ourselves.

Yeah, I’m kinda like this. There are definitely days when I wouldn’t rather been born a cis man, but then I remember how being born as a trans man has allowed me to experience things and understand things in a way cis men would never be able to. For example, I understand a lot of issues that women face much better than a cis man would, because I’ve experienced a lot of them myself. If I was born a cis man, there definitely would’ve been a good chance of me falling down the right wing rabbit hole. Being a trans man has allowed me to avoid that much more easily, and I’ve been able to accept people’s differences more easily as well. So honesty, even if I was given the opportunity to start all over as a cis man, I don’t think I would. Being a trans man, while it has caused a lot of hardship and pain, has also enriched my life and those hardships have made me a stronger person.
